Let's be real: it's getting harder and harder to afford technology, especially with rising costs and tariffs. If a new phone, tablet, or smartwatch feels out of reach, you may want to check out this Verizon deal: Trade in select phones from brands like Apple, Google, Motorola, or Samsung, while being a new or existing customer of the provider's myPlans, and receive a free iPhone Pro, iPad, and Apple Watch.

That's right: All three devices are free.

Also: The best Memorial Day deals

The fine print, of course, is that you'll have to pay for a service plan for the iPad and Apple Watch along with the phone. But that's still thousands of dollars worth of tech for free.

More details: You will be locked in a 3-year contract, as the devices will be paid out monthly for 26 months. Some people don't like that type of commitment, and that's understandable.

You will also have to pay sales tax for the devices and pay for your new Verizon plan. Therefore, it's up to you to decide whether the new devices are worth these fees.
